Output 761896b34e300dc090f215b3c9a419de337bcc4d3e6968b0af76268fdd200ca5:0

value
2006
script pubkey
OP_0 OP_PUSHBYTES_20 9423af810720f6253ffc5da0d72015a5cd78cb20
address
tb1qjs36lqg8yrmz20lutksdwgq45hxh3jeq3km7s6
transaction
761896b34e300dc090f215b3c9a419de337bcc4d3e6968b0af76268fdd200ca5
confirmations
21686
spent
true